Abstract

The invention discloses a strong shock-absorption type rear suspension device of an automobile cab. The strong vibration-attenuation type rear suspension device comprises a left mechanism and a right mechanism, wherein the left mechanism and the right mechanism are in bilateral symmetry and have the consistent structure; the left mechanism is connected with the right mechanism by an oil tube and a beam; in the left mechanism and the right mechanism, the lower part of an upper connecting bracket is movably connected with a support trench on a hydraulic lock by a middle shaft; the lower part of the hydraulic lock is fixedly connected with the upper end of a middle connecting bracket; a side end of the middle connecting bracket is connected with a lateral shock absorber; the bottom end of the middle connecting bracket is in threaded connection with a spring shock absorber; the lower part of the spring shock absorber is connected with the middle part of the lower connecting bracket; the top of the lower connecting bracket is connected with a front beam and a back beam; and the front beam and the back beam are respectively connected with the lateral shock absorber by front and back beam connecting plates. The strong shock-absorption type rear suspension device has good lateral buffer performance, does not cause reciprocating sidesway of the cab, improves driving safety, can avoid motion discordance with the vertical motion of the cab, has strong guidance action for parts, and can effectively prevent the parts from sliding.

Description

Technical field [0001] The invention relates to a vibration damping device for automobiles, in particular to a rear suspension device of a strong damping type automobile cab, which is particularly suitable for attenuating vibration transmitted from a frame to the cab. Background technique [0002] The strong damping type automobile cab rear suspension device is a device that floats the cab and the frame. It has a good damping function and can attenuate the vibration transmitted from the frame to the cab. The traditional rear suspension devices used to connect the car cab and the frame are only equipped with shock absorbers in the vertical direction, while the sideways generally use connecting plates with rubber bushings or tie rods as guiding and restraining elements.
